Docker - Window环境下安装,使用入门hello-world示例

安装

  • https://www.docker.com/products/docker-toolbox 下载所需安装包docker-toolbox, 之后直接机械式下一步安装。
    之后在桌面会出现三个图标:
    Docker - Window环境下安装,使用入门hello-world示例

  • 双击 Docker Quickstart Terminal 进入docker工作界面, 第一次安装会下载一些东西,速度会比较慢点。
    如果通过github下载 boot2docker.iso 文件慢或者下载失败的话,可以直接人工手动将boot2docker.iso下载到本地,再将这个文件复制到本地user 目录下的.docker\machine\cache文件夹下 ,如C:\Users\wugang.docker\machine\cache

中间过程可能会需要你输入Docker Hub的账号和密码,自己可以单独申请 https://hub.docker.com/

  • 安装好之后就会进入工作台界面,可以输入 docker info 命令来查看当前安装的docker的信息。

Docker - Window环境下安装,使用入门hello-world示例

  • 因为docker本身的命令操作界面不能复制粘贴,使用起来不方便,我们可以使用其他的工具如XShell来连接我们的Docker服务器,在xshell中编辑相关命令操作。

安装好Xshell之后,通过ssh的方式连接,通过 ifconfig 命令查看Docker的IP地址,默认的用户名和密码是: docker/tcuser
Docker - Window环境下安装,使用入门hello-world示例

进入到XShell界面,就可以来操作Docker相关命令了。

hello-world使用示例

  • 可以通过 docker pull hello-world 命令将 hello-world镜像从仓库 https://hub.docker.com//hello-world/ 上pull下来,
    Docker - Window环境下安装,使用入门hello-world示例

  • 执行 docker run hello-world 命令,执行hello-world镜像
    Docker - Window环境下安装,使用入门hello-world示例

  • 可以 docker images 查看本机images